青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品

牽著老婆滿街逛

嚴以律己,寬以待人. 三思而后行.
GMail/GTalk: yanglinbo#google.com;
MSN/Email: tx7do#yahoo.com.cn;
QQ: 3 0 3 3 9 6 9 2 0 .

libjingle翻譯之《Important Concepts(重要概念)之Candidates(候選)》

轉(zhuǎn)載自:http://blog.csdn.net/night_cat/article/details/3501217

Candidates(候選)

libjingle一個主要的好處就是它可以穿透防火墻和NAT設(shè)備進行鏈接協(xié)商。libjingle使用ICE機制穿透防火墻。libjingle應用程序第一步要做的就是在試圖協(xié)商一個鏈接時為其它計算機的鏈入創(chuàng)建一個潛在的本地端口地址鏈表。鏈表中的每個潛在的地址就稱作一個候選。候選就是“IP地址:端口”對應對,這些對應對使應用程序和其它計算機互聯(lián)(技術(shù)上,這些對應對只在本地機上監(jiān)聽)。libjingle提供了強壯的機制在本地鏈接上發(fā)現(xiàn)候選供其它計算機進入,甚至穿透防火墻或NAT設(shè)備。

為了向其它計算機提供盡可能多的候選鏈接地址,libjingle生成三種本地候選:

 Local IP addresses 一種候選是計算機上的本地IP地址。與它共同在一個網(wǎng)絡中的其它計算機能夠通過這個候選進入。

 Global addresses第二種候選是兩個計算機之間的NAT或防火墻設(shè)備的對外地址。如果這個候選是NAT設(shè)備對外地址,libjingle使用心跳包使NAT端口與本地機綁定起來并對外公布這個全局地址。這個全局地址被作為從NAT對外地址鏈接進入的候選。

A second candidate is an external address on a NAT or firewall device between the two computers. If this

is outside a NAT device, libjingle uses STUN to cause the NAT to bind to your computer and expose a global address.

This address is used as a candidate to connect from outside the NAT device.

 Relay server addresses 大約有8%的鏈接嘗試在穿越防火墻時,上述方法失敗。第三種方法就是在兩個防火墻之間進行服務器中轉(zhuǎn)。盡管libjingle有能力使用中轉(zhuǎn)服務器,但是沒有提供中轉(zhuǎn)服務器的URIlibjingle包含中轉(zhuǎn)服務的代碼(relayserver.h)。應用程序可以自己創(chuàng)建和運行這個服務,使用方法是以中轉(zhuǎn)服務器的IP地址做為BasicPortAllocator的構(gòu)造函數(shù)的第三個參數(shù)。

下面的圖演示了兩臺計算機之間生成的  local addrress 候選(C1),external NAT 候選(C2),Relay server候選(C3)。

 Candidate selection diagram

 

libjingle以鏈表的形式儲存著全部的候選,這樣可以做到在鏈接建立后,libjingle能夠在當前鏈接遲緩或中斷后很快地切換到新的鏈接上。

libjingle包支持多種傳輸方式,實現(xiàn)了Jingle<transport>元素表現(xiàn)出來的精神。一個transport元素能夠包含比簡單的候選地址更多的信息:例如:ICE標簽支持像優(yōu)先權(quán),密碼,用戶碎片(user fragments)的特殊ICE。盡管這是協(xié)商鏈接的首選方法,為了向下兼容的正規(guī)考慮,libjingle仍然支持客戶繼續(xù)使用老式的<candidate>節(jié)。請查看Jingle ICE Transport Specification 里的transport詳細說明。(對這一段的翻譯無自信,把原文附出,請高手指教。)

libjingle now includes support for multiple transports, in the spirit of the Jingle <transport> element. A transport can contain much more information than a simple candidate address: for example, the ICE transport tag supports ICE-specific information such as priority, password, and user fragments. Although this is the preferred way to negotiate connections, for backward compatibility purposes libjingle still supports clients that still use the older bare <candidate> stanza. See the Jingle ICE Transport Specification for an example of a transport specification.




posted on 2013-09-02 00:11 楊粼波 閱讀(376) 評論(0)  編輯 收藏 引用


只有注冊用戶登錄后才能發(fā)表評論。
網(wǎng)站導航: 博客園   IT新聞   BlogJava   博問   Chat2DB   管理


青青草原综合久久大伊人导航_色综合久久天天综合_日日噜噜夜夜狠狠久久丁香五月_热久久这里只有精品
  • <ins id="pjuwb"></ins>
    <blockquote id="pjuwb"><pre id="pjuwb"></pre></blockquote>
    <noscript id="pjuwb"></noscript>
          <sup id="pjuwb"><pre id="pjuwb"></pre></sup>
            <dd id="pjuwb"></dd>
            <abbr id="pjuwb"></abbr>
            久久一日本道色综合久久| 久久电影一区| 欧美一区二区三区久久精品| 日韩午夜中文字幕| 99精品视频一区| 亚洲一区二区视频在线观看| 亚洲一区二区综合| 午夜精品视频在线观看| 久久久7777| 亚洲国产精品一区二区尤物区| 麻豆成人在线| 亚洲国产天堂久久国产91| 日韩视频中午一区| 亚洲欧美综合另类中字| 欧美一区二区视频在线| 久久中文久久字幕| 亚洲成人在线视频网站| 亚洲毛片网站| 久久se精品一区二区| 美女久久网站| 国产精品网站视频| 亚洲第一中文字幕| 亚洲一二三区精品| 免费亚洲一区二区| 亚洲视频在线播放| 欧美成人精品一区二区三区| 国产精品网站一区| 日韩网站免费观看| 久久在线观看视频| 亚洲视频在线观看三级| 欧美黄色aa电影| 韩国视频理论视频久久| 亚洲一区二区三区精品动漫| 亚洲激情成人网| 欧美中文日韩| 欧美电影资源| 亚洲欧美制服另类日韩| 欧美国产视频在线观看| 国产亚洲精品久| 亚洲伊人久久综合| 91久久久久久| 美女主播视频一区| 国产日韩欧美成人| 亚洲欧美国产视频| 亚洲精品一区二| 老司机午夜精品视频| 国产欧美日韩精品丝袜高跟鞋 | 在线成人免费观看| 欧美一区二区黄色| 夜夜狂射影院欧美极品| 欧美精品综合| 91久久精品国产91久久性色| 久久一区中文字幕| 久久高清国产| 国精产品99永久一区一区| 午夜欧美电影在线观看| 在线一区二区三区做爰视频网站| 欧美精品一级| 一本久道综合久久精品| 亚洲国产精品成人精品| 欧美aⅴ一区二区三区视频| 在线观看日韩av电影| 欧美freesex8一10精品| 久久这里有精品视频| 狠狠色丁香婷婷综合| 美女免费视频一区| 欧美freesex8一10精品| 99re8这里有精品热视频免费| 91久久中文字幕| 欧美日韩精品免费观看视一区二区| 99re8这里有精品热视频免费| 亚洲精品乱码久久久久久蜜桃91 | 欧美日韩高清在线| 亚洲一区中文字幕在线观看| 亚洲一区欧美| 狠狠色狠狠色综合人人| 亚洲高清免费| 欧美揉bbbbb揉bbbbb| 性欧美大战久久久久久久免费观看| 亚洲香蕉在线观看| 国产亚洲在线| 欧美激情va永久在线播放| 欧美日本精品| 久久精品国产免费| 欧美成人免费全部| 亚洲在线成人精品| 久久精品日韩| 一区二区三区波多野结衣在线观看| 亚洲特黄一级片| 亚洲欧洲综合另类| 99综合在线| 国产亚洲欧美日韩一区二区| 女主播福利一区| 欧美日韩精品福利| 久久久午夜电影| 欧美成人高清视频| 欧美在线国产| 欧美jizz19hd性欧美| 亚洲综合丁香| 两个人的视频www国产精品| 亚洲一级网站| 久久疯狂做爰流白浆xx| 宅男噜噜噜66国产日韩在线观看| 午夜伦理片一区| 99精品欧美| 久久理论片午夜琪琪电影网| 亚洲欧美日韩人成在线播放| 久久中文字幕一区二区三区| 午夜视频在线观看一区二区| 免费美女久久99| 久久男人资源视频| 国产精品久久久久99| 亚洲国产婷婷香蕉久久久久久| 国产精品视频免费观看www| 亚洲第一福利在线观看| 国产专区综合网| 亚洲欧美在线播放| 亚洲一区二区视频在线| 欧美精品在线一区| 欧美国产免费| 在线欧美日韩国产| 久久黄色级2电影| 欧美在线电影| 国产精品视频你懂的| 一本色道久久综合| 99精品欧美一区| 欧美激情精品久久久久久久变态| 免费成人高清视频| 一区二区三区在线免费播放| 午夜宅男欧美| 久久狠狠亚洲综合| 国产精品一区在线观看你懂的| 在线视频亚洲一区| 亚洲影视在线播放| 欧美午夜性色大片在线观看| 亚洲精品一区二区在线观看| 99re6热只有精品免费观看| 欧美精品一区二区在线播放| 亚洲精品美女91| 亚洲性视频网站| 国产精品亚洲精品| 欧美在线观看一区| 欧美jizzhd精品欧美喷水| 亚洲高清在线播放| 欧美成人小视频| 亚洲精品在线看| 亚洲欧美日韩一区二区在线 | 国产综合视频| 欧美一区亚洲一区| 男人插女人欧美| 亚洲国产综合91精品麻豆| 牛人盗摄一区二区三区视频| 亚洲国产一二三| 亚洲欧美一区二区三区久久| 国产精品女人毛片| 亚洲与欧洲av电影| 久久亚洲精品网站| 亚洲黄色在线视频| 欧美性猛片xxxx免费看久爱| 亚洲一区二区三区在线观看视频 | 亚洲国产精品尤物yw在线观看| 久久尤物电影视频在线观看| 亚洲成色999久久网站| 一区二区三区蜜桃网| 国产欧美在线观看| 农村妇女精品| 亚洲一区二区三区成人在线视频精品| 久久爱另类一区二区小说| 欲色影视综合吧| 欧美日韩亚洲国产精品| 欧美一区日韩一区| 亚洲国产一成人久久精品| 欧美一区二区高清| 亚洲免费高清| 国产揄拍国内精品对白| 美女黄毛**国产精品啪啪| 亚洲高清色综合| 久久精品亚洲一区二区三区浴池 | 日韩一二三区视频| 国产日韩在线视频| 欧美精品国产| 亚洲免费网站| 亚洲国产精品电影在线观看| 午夜精品久久久久久久白皮肤| 有码中文亚洲精品| 国产精品丝袜91| 欧美精品在线看| 久久综合网色—综合色88| 亚洲视频一区二区免费在线观看| 欧美va亚洲va香蕉在线| 欧美一区二区三区视频在线| 亚洲精选91| 136国产福利精品导航| 国产麻豆综合| 国产精品vip| 欧美精品在线免费观看| 免费影视亚洲| 久久精品视频在线播放| 亚洲欧美清纯在线制服| 夜夜爽www精品|